Transaction 1996fca66760b92c1f4cb34688adbcfa1066e75acf758a85d31edf0e7c2fc903
1 Input
1 Output
-
1996fca66760b92c1f4cb34688adbcfa1066e75acf758a85d31edf0e7c2fc903:0
- value
- 357050553
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a9ad77da1b7c9cb3e4b277a87fed4f3d8c58e36
- address
- bc1q82ddwldpklyuk0jtyaag0lk570vvtr3kq46pdk